Welcome aboard! The metrics sidecar, Gaugelet, runs next to every service pod and ships counters to our Brimstat aggregator every ten seconds. You won't need to touch its config much — just make sure your service exposes the standard /gauges endpoint and Gaugelet picks it up automatically. For local testing, point Gaugelet at the Brimstat staging cluster. It authenticates with an internal key, which you'll find right below this paragraph.

API key for yahig-tadup: kto7_ubizbYm

Ticket: Staging env misconfigured for Siftgate bloom filter

The bloom layer in front of the Pellet KV store is rejecting all lookups in staging because the env file was copied from the dev template without credentials. False-positive tuning values are fine; only the auth line is missing. To unblock the weekly demo, the Pellet admission secret must be set on the following line.

env line for yaguf-fajop: LEDGER_TOKEN13=fb08984397349

Handover — Tovren quota service

Shift summary: per-tenant rate quotas on Tovren are misbehaving for three large tenants after yesterday's limit recalibration. Quota counters reset mid-window, so some tenants briefly got double their allowance. I patched the scheduler and froze recalibration; Marisol is reviewing the fix tomorrow. Watch for 429 spikes on the Brackenfold gateway dashboard. If counters drift again, restart quota-sync, not the gateway. Incident notes and remaining tasks are on the internal handover page.

operations page: https://jira.qorvelsys.internal/browse/pages/browse/pages

## Changelog — Sweeper 3.2

Renamed RETENTION_PURGE_DAYS to SWEEP_RETENTION_DAYS across the Dustbin sweeper. Old name is ignored as of this release; update your env files now. Default remains 90 days. Dry-run mode still uses SWEEP_DRY_RUN=1. The sweeper also now requires authenticated access to the archive vault, so directly after the retention setting your env file must declare the vault credential on its own line.

vault entry, yahif-yajep: COURIER_KEY29=b802bdf8034096b65a51c6ba5abe2